Description
The compilation features 19 CSN classics, including Our House, Suite: Judy Blue Eyes, Marrakesh Express, and Guinnevere. In 1969 the founding members of three of the most acclaimed bands of the 60s united to form the first rock supergroup - Crosby, Stills and Nash. Crosby had been a member of the Byrds, Nash was in the Hollies and stills had been part of Buffalo Springfield. The resulting trio was characterised by a unique vocal blend and musical approach that ranged from acoustic folk to melodic pop to hard rock. Crosby Stills and Nash were one of the most successful touring and recording acts of the late 60s, 70s, and early 80s. By combining their talents they created one of the biggest super-groups of all time. The trio had their own unique sound with rich blended vocals ranging in style from acoustic folk to hard rock and they wrote many classic tracks reflecting the social and political changes throughout their thirty-five year career. For the very first time the greatest hits brings together 19 newly remastered signature tracks from this grammy award-winning group. Crosby Stills and Nash's vocal harmonies and songs of social relevance have stood the test of time and they remain at the forefront of popular music.
